The American automaker, Jeep has teased the fans all over the world with a new teaser. As the Jeep Compass will be completing ten years in the market, this video gives hints on a new Jeep Compass. It is said to be sharing the platform and engines with the new generation of the Peugeot 3008.
The brand has been quite active on its social networks with the release of teasers for the model. One such is the video named "TechTalks with Ned Curic: Ep.1 - AI", through which the head of the group's engineering and technology department talks about the impact of AI on the automotive industry and at 1:20 minute, it is possible to see sketches of the new Jeep Compass 2025.
In the teaser video, the technical drawings on the engineers' computers. It hints towards the design of the Peugeot 3008 getting adapted by the new Jeep Compass meaning it is likely to share the same Stellantis STLA Medium platform. However, it is not possible to get an idea of all the aesthetic changes of the SUV. Yet, the video showcases evidence of changes in the wheel arches, roof, and side panels.
The SUV could feature vertical side surfaces, inspired by the off-road world, and a characteristically Jeep front end, with the traditional seven-slot grille and square wheel arches.
Apart from that, in the teaser, the inscription J4U appears showing information on BEV Mass which is a significant figure for an electric SUV. It is expected that the SUV will be offered with engine options, including mild hybrid and 100% electric versions.
The new Jeep Compass will initially be produced at the Melfi plant in Italy. As for its debut, the brand has yet to make any announcement we will have to wait for any further information from them.
